What is stronger stainless steel or silver? On the Mohs Scale of Hardness, stainless steel beats sterling silver by several points. The silver alloy is as easily damaged as gold, the softest jewelry of all.

Is stainless steel the same as silver? Silver and stainless steel are both used in jewelry because they are both shiny, silvery metals when polished, but the similarities end right there. Silver is not just a metal, but an element. Its chemical symbol is Ag, for Argentum, the Latin word for the metal.

Is silver stronger than steel? Steel is stronger than sterling silver, resisting high pressure and scratching. The metal is much more difficult to break or otherwise irreparably damage. However, sterling silver is more flexible. Because it bends more easily, it can last a person longer through multiple resizing and repairs.

What is the difference between steel and silver? While stainless steel is known for its durability, sterling silver is the more elegant and malleable choice for intricate designs such as custom jewelry. Additionally, sterling silver is lighter compared to stainless steel.

How do I know what silverware I have? Buff the silverware to a shine with a soft, non-abrasive white cloth. If the silverware is real, it will leave a slight (or not so slight) black mark. Real silver chemically reacts with oxygen to form a patina (tarnish) while silver plating bonds to the underlying metal, so stainless steel will not leave such a mark.

How do you remove a heavy stain from silverware? For silverware, jewelry and other small silver items, soak them in a glass bowl with half a cup of distilled white vinegar and two tablespoons of baking soda. Let the silver soak for three hours, wash the items and dry and polish them with a microfiber cloth.

How do you remove tarnish from silver forks?

Place the silver objects in a bowl of suitable size and cover them with white distilled vinegar. Add baking soda to the bowl – the approximate proportions are 4 tablespoons of baking soda for every cup of vinegar. Leave the silver in the mixture for 1 hour. Rinse with clean water and dry well with a soft cotton cloth.

What is the highest quality of stainless steel dish? 18/10 flatware is the best quality stainless steel flatware. Typically of the extra heavy weight variety, 18/10 flatware feels sturdy in the hand, and is harder to bend, making it a long-lasting choice of flatware. In addition, the 10 percent nickel gives it a brighter shine and improved corrosion protection.

What is the silverware of the Oneida Community? Oneida Community began production of silver-plated server and flatware in 1899 using the “Community Plate” mark. Oneida Community purchased the Wm A. Rogers and 1881 Rogers companies in 1929 and began producing a somewhat lower quality line of products using those companies’ brands.

How can you tell if flatware is forged?

Forged flatware is made from a thick piece of stainless steel that is heated and cut to shape each tool. Stamped plate is cut like a stamp from a piece of stainless steel. Because of the heating process, forged plates are stronger than stamped plates, which are more flexible.
